Guest User

Untitled

a guest
Aug 16th, 2018
75
0
Never
Not a member of Pastebin yet? Sign Up, it unlocks many cool features!
text 1.18 KB | None | 0 0
  1. set shell=/bin/bash
  2. set nocompatible
  3. set tabstop=2
  4. set expandtab
  5. set shiftwidth=2
  6. set softtabstop=2
  7. set number
  8.  
  9. filetype off
  10.  
  11. " Remappings
  12. nnoremap \| :
  13. nnoremap \ /
  14. nnoremap <S-Up> :m-2<CR>
  15. nnoremap <S-Down> :m+1<CR>
  16. nmap <c-s> :w<CR>
  17.  
  18. inoremap <S-Up> <Esc>:m-2<CR>
  19. inoremap <S-Down> <Esc>:m+1<CR>
  20. imap <c-s> <Esc>:w<CR>a
  21.  
  22. :syntax on
  23.  
  24. set rtp+=~/.vim/bundle/Vundle.vim
  25. call vundle#begin()
  26. " All my plugins
  27.  
  28. Plugin 'vundleVim/Vundle.vim' " Vundle itself
  29. Plugin 'scrooloose/nerdtree' " NerdTree
  30. Plugin 'sfi0zy/atlantic-dark' " Theme
  31. Plugin 'mattn/emmet-vim' " Emmet
  32. Plugin 'itchyny/lightline.vim' " Lightline
  33. Plugin 'terryma/vim-multiple-cursors' " Multiple cursors
  34. Plugin 'tpope/vim-surround' " Surround ()[]...
  35. Plugin 'pangloss/vim-javascript' " JavaScript Syntax
  36.  
  37. call vundle#end()
  38.  
  39. colorscheme atlantic-dark
  40. set cursorline
  41. filetype plugin indent on
  42.  
  43. " NERDTree Configs
  44. let NERDTreeWinPos = "left"
  45. let NERDTreeMinimalUI = 1
  46. let NERDTreeDirArrows = 1
  47.  
  48. autocmd StdInReadPre * let s:std_in=1
  49. autocmd VimEnter * if argc() == 0 && !exists("s:std_in") | NERDTree | endif
  50.  
  51. map <C-n> :NERDTreeToggle<CR>
Add Comment
Please, Sign In to add comment